The idea that gratitude is the secret to happiness is nothing new, I know, and it is certainly not earth shattering, but I feel like I have stumbled upon the answer to some great mystery. Everyone wants to be happier, don't they? Well, I know that in order to be happy, I have to be grateful. And so today, on this first day of November, I am grateful to have a heart full of gratitude. It lightens my loads and makes my burdens seem less burdensome. This hymn describes it so well:


 When upon life's billows you are tempest-tossed, When you are discouraged, thinking all is lost, Count your many blessings; name them one by one, And it will surprise you what the Lord has done.

Are you ever burdened with a load of care? Does the cross seem heavy you are called to bear? Count your many blessings, ev'ry doubt will fly, And you will be singing as the days go by.

When you look at others with their lands and gold, Think that Christ has promised you his wealth untold. Count your many blessings, money cannot buy Your reward in heaven or your home on high.

So amid the conflict whether great or small, Do not be discouraged; God is over all. Count your many blessings; angels will attend, Help and comfort give you to your journey's end.
